You have 2 options transfer to Geiranger, Norway from Bergen below

Ferry ( 13 hr. 30 min. )

Take a ferry from Bergen Nøstet Hurtigrutekai to Ålesund Hurtigrutekai.


Open Map More details & check price at Hurtigruten
Walk ( 12 min. )

Take a foot from Ålesund Hurtigrutekai to Ålesund rutebilstasjon hurtigbåtkai.


Ferry ( 3 hr. )

Take a ferry from Ålesund rutebilstasjon hurtigbåtkai to Geiranger hurtigbåtkai.


Open Map More details & check price at Geiranger Fjordservice
Duration 17 hr. 42 min.
Distance 424 km.
